excel 将已复制控件的事件触发器复制到新的多页

ha5z0ras  于 2023-03-09  发布在  其他
关注(0)|答案(1)|浏览(129)

我正在为我们公司创建一些自动化软件,根据所选Excel文件中的一些数据动态创建多页页面。我在对象查看器上设置了控件,并触发事件(即DblClick列表框或组合框)。
This is my base UserForm with a Parent Multipage which contains a Listbox and another Multipage (child) that contains Frames with Labels, ComboBoxes, and Command Buttons.
如何将与对象关联的事件复制到新的多页?
I have started copying the existing objects already, but it's not complete.
我一直在谷歌上搜索复制事件的方法,但查询与某些关键字无关。我正在寻找事件复制的资源,但似乎是有限的。似乎Copy event handler assignment to another instance上的addressOf函数在引用另一个函数时有问题。

b4lqfgs4

b4lqfgs41#

我已经按照类中事件处理程序的一些引用复制了事件触发器。
创建了自己的类来保存ListBox和ComboBox,然后分配了一个包含所需的每个控件的计数的动态数组。将现有控件和新控件与类数组相关联允许在类中使用事件处理程序。
工作起来很有魅力!阶级统治!

相关问题